NewQuest inks five Houston-area deals

NewQuest Properties recently completed five transactions—two leases and three acquisitions—in South Texas. The Ranch Office at Katy Boardwalk has leased 16,312 square feet of office space in Boardwalk Crossing Phase I, located at the intersection of Kingsland Boulevard and AMC Drive in Katy, Texas, from Boardwalk Crossing LLC. Bob Conwell of NewQuest Properties represented the landlord. Jeff Goldberg of Gold Key Partners represented the tenant. Eye Boutique LLC has leased 1,634 square feet of retail space in Washington Central, 4015 Washington Avenue in Houston, from DZ Washington LLC. Nick Ramsey and Ashley Strickland of NewQuest Properties represented the landlord. Mike Ashmore of Engel & Volkers represented the tenant. Humble Westfield Property Inc. has purchased 4.41 acres at 14910 Humble Westfield Road in Humble, Texas from Macau Realty Inc. Dave Ramsey and Brad Elmore of NewQuest Properties represented the seller. Anne Vickery of Anne Vickery & Associates LLC represented the buyer. LoRey Properties LLC has purchased a 13,740-square-foot warehouse on 0.46 acres at 4750 Irvington Boulevard in Houston, from Ruiz Wholesale Co. Chris Dray of NewQuest Properties represented the seller. Juan Miranda of Mission Realty represented the buyer. American Food of Beaumont LLC has purchased 1.56 acres at 510 Interstate 10 N in Beaumont, Texas from Calder 10 Ltd. John Nguyen and Grace La of NewQuest Properties represented the buyer. Sam Parigi of Parigi Investments Inc. represented the seller.
